+Hitman9956 Posted September 21, 2017 Share Posted September 21, 2017 I pay for my membership every three months and have done since I started caching in 2013. Today, Android App asks me to upgrade - yet the website shows I am fully paid until Mid December. App refuses to allow me to access Premium. Turns out Google Play had an old card that expired, so Google has switched off Premium on the App until I put a new card in - or forced Groundspeak to allow them to do this. I paid a month at £4 odd to fix this, app works fine now, adds a month to 3 month paid meaning renewal mid January 2018, Google get their new card details - no way to argue and cannot remove card details. Not sure if its Groundspeak or Google at fault, but between them it shows Android up to be an absolute poor option for caching. I for one cannot wait to go back to an Iphone as it never forced me like this. Not very happy Quote Link to comment

+kunarion Posted August 4, 2019 Share Posted August 4, 2019 (edited) 57 minutes ago, peterd8411 said: It's not working for me either! I've never used geocaching before. I installed the app for the first time today and upgraded to premium immediately. It takes a couple of hours for the account information to sync with the App. Notice the others above who "have the same problem" have since found Premium Caches and only one or two returned to this thread to mention that the issue vanished.
